Alvorligheder is the plural of alvorlighed, a Danish noun meaning seriousness, gravity, or severity. It refers to the quality of being serious or to the seriousness of a matter, situation, or condition. The term is used in both formal and everyday Danish to describe the weight or import of risks, consequences, and moral considerations.
